Hi, af arrived 28/12/24 normal 28 day cycle. I got a positive test 22/1/25. So I worked out that my due date would be 4th Oct.

Anyway the midwife phoned me to book me in for bloods etc and she got my due date at 28/9/25

Am I missing something? That would put me at 6 weeks 3 days not 5 weeks 4 days which I originally thought.

The midwife should go with LMP initially until your 12 week dating scan.

28th December plus 40 weeks would be 4th October, no? I'm with you on this.

Regardless, you will get your official due date at your scan so that should clear up any discrepancies
